At Willington Train Station, you'll find the essentials required for a smooth travel experience without any extravagant frills. While there is no ticket office, passengers can use ticket machines for all on-site purchases. However, do note that tickets bought online can't be collected here. Smartcard holders will find validators available, which adds convenience for frequent travelers.
As part of its basic offerings, Willington Train Station is equipped with CCTV to enhance passenger safety. Though devoid of a waiting room and seating areas, the station compensates with its straightforward and unpretentious architecture which adds to its rustic charm. Unfortunately, facilities such as public toilets, accessible toilets, and refreshment outlets are non-existent, so plan accordingly before your visit.
Whether you're heading to Birmingham, Derby, or even further afield, Willington offers viable connections to a plethora of destinations. The station's services seamlessly link with buses for those last-mile journeys. Printable bus information is available to assist you in planning your onward journey. Additionally, for those occasions where rail replacements are necessary, buses depart conveniently from the stops outside the nearby Green Man pub.

At Hassocks Station, ticket purchasing is made easy with both a staffed ticket office and user-friendly machines equipped to handle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. The ticket office opens early at 06:10 AM on weekdays, perfect for your morning commute, and is staffed until the evening. Smartcard users will also find validators for easy access. Despite the station's lack of waiting rooms, there are seating areas available on-site.
Accessibility is forefront at Hassocks, offering step-free access to all platforms, a ramp for train access, and visibly available customer help points. Hassocks Station is well-monitored with CCTV but does not provide public Wi-Fi. Though amenities are modest with no shops or ATMs, refreshment facilities are available for travelers requiring a quick bite or drink.
Hassocks' transport links extend beyond train services, with bus connections that make onward travel straightforward. Although not featured in the station itself, local taxis offer additional travel solutions for those arriving at or departing from Hassocks.
